Big Data Analytics: Unlocking Insights from Massive Datasets
In today's digital age, data is being generated at an unprecedented rate. This explosion of data, often referred to as "big data," presents both challenges and opportunities for businesses and organizations. Big data analytics, a field that involves the collection, storage, processing, and analysis of large datasets, has emerged as a critical tool for extracting valuable insights and making informed decisions.
What is Big Data?
Big data is characterized by its volume, velocity, variety, and veracity.
- Volume: Refers to the sheer amount of data generated.
- Velocity: Relates to the speed at which data is created and processed.
- Variety: Describes the diverse types of data, including structured, unstructured, and semi-structured formats.
- Veracity: Concerns the quality and accuracy of the data.
The Importance of Big Data Analytics
Big data analytics offers numerous benefits for businesses and organizations, including:
- Improved Decision Making: By analyzing large datasets, organizations can gain deeper insights into customer behavior, market trends, and operational efficiency. This enables them to make data-driven decisions that lead to better outcomes. ?
- Enhanced Customer Experience: Big data analytics can be used to personalize customer experiences by understanding individual preferences and tailoring products or services accordingly.
- Optimized Operations: Analyzing operational data can help identify inefficiencies, reduce costs, and improve overall performance.
- Risk Management: Big data analytics can be used to detect and mitigate risks, such as fraud, security breaches, and supply chain disruptions.
- Innovation: By leveraging big data, organizations can discover new opportunities, develop innovative products and services, and gain a competitive advantage.
Key Techniques and Technologies
- Hadoop: A distributed computing framework that can handle massive datasets across clusters of commodity hardware.
- Spark: A fast and general-purpose cluster computing system that can be used for a wide range of big data applications.
- NoSQL Databases: Databases designed to handle large volumes of unstructured or semi-structured data.
- Machine Learning: A subset of artificial intelligence that involves training algorithms to learn from data and make predictions.
- Data Visualization: Techniques for presenting data in a visual format to make it easier to understand and interpret.
Challenges and Considerations
While big data analytics offers significant benefits, it also presents challenges:
- Data Quality: Ensuring the accuracy and reliability of data is essential for meaningful analysis.
- Data Privacy and Security: Protecting sensitive data from unauthorized access and breaches is a major concern.
- Talent Shortage: Finding skilled professionals with expertise in big data analytics can be difficult.
- Infrastructure Costs: Investing in the necessary hardware and software infrastructure can be expensive.
As the volume and complexity of data continue to grow, the importance of big data analytics will only increase. By leveraging the power of big data, organizations can unlock valuable insights, drive innovation, and gain a competitive edge in today's data-driven world.